背景情况:
- 博茨瓦纳的癌症发病率上升与衰老,生活方式和艾滋病毒有关.
- 建立了四个公共瘤中心 (POC),以改善癌症护理的准入.
- 需要进行评估,以评估当前的癌症护理特征.
研究的目的:
- 评估博茨瓦纳四个公共瘤中心癌症护理服务的特点和可用性.
- 识别诊断,治疗和支持性护理服务中的差距.
- 为未来博茨瓦纳瘤服务的发展提供信息.
主要方法:
- 在四家医院 (PMH,NRH,SMH,LMH) 进行了瘤学工作人员的多站点横截面调查.
- 通过焦点人员收集的2021年2月至4月的数据,确认服务可用性.
- 调查评估了51名瘤学工作人员对服务的可用性.
主要成果:
- 公主玛丽娜医院 (PMH) 和Nyangabgwe推医院 (NRH) 提供综合服务;地区中心 (SMH,LMH) 的容量有限.
- PMH独特地提供住院瘤学,多学科委员会和息护理.
- 所有中心都提供帕普检测; 乳房检查仅限于PMH/NRH的诊断; 放射治疗需要转诊.
结论:
- 在博茨瓦纳国家转诊医院和地区POC之间,癌症护理服务存在显著差异.
- 地区中心 (SMH,LMH) 需要发展以提供特定的癌症服务,随访和息护理.
- 加强地区级POC的服务对于解决博茨瓦纳日益增长的癌症负担至关重要.

The targeted cancer therapies, also known as “molecular targeted therapies,” take advantage of the molecular and genetic differences between the cancer cells and the normal cells. It needs a thorough understanding of the cancer cells to develop drugs that can target specific molecular aspects that drive the growth, progression, and spread of cancer cells without affecting the growth and survival of other normal cells in the body.

Cancer survival analysis focuses on quantifying and interpreting the time from a key starting point, such as diagnosis or the initiation of treatment, to a specific endpoint, such as remission or death. This analysis provides critical insights into treatment effectiveness and factors that influence patient outcomes, helping to shape clinical decisions and guide prognostic evaluations.
